Yea sorry for the delay, as mentioned above, it was the many new features for me. The car is pretty loaded, from the blind spot camera, brake hold(which at first I thought was silly but it is actually convenient), being able to see music, fuel ranges, etc in the dashboard plus the touchscreen display. I also like the Apple Carplay, actually too many to mention from my '93 Honda Accord(it had power windows and a sunroof) which I actually still have for now and drive to work on shitty weather days, it cost $15 a month to insure. I got the Rallye Red and looking to tint the windows and get a clear bra here in the next few weeks and probably switching out some of the speakers down the road. It's defintely a lot of fun to drive, it's got some get up.
